Top 5 Crime Games in Turkey: Q3 2022 Performance
Explore the performance metrics of the top 5 crime games on a unified platform in Turkey during Q3 2022, including down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2022, the top 5 crime games in Turkey showcased varying perform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a comprehensive look at these trends.
Thief Puzzle: to pass a level saw fluctuating weekly downloads, starting at 42K in late June and peaking at 72K in mid-July. Revenue for the game reached its highest at $15 in the last week of September, while active users peaked at around 150K in mid-July before declining to approximately 63K by the end of Q3.
Airport Security experienced a peak in weekly downloads at 83K in mid-July, with a noticeable decline to 12K by mid-September. Revenue reached a high of $54 in early July but tapered off to $6 by the end of the quarter. Active users showed a peak at 230K in mid-July, gradually decreasing to about 113K by the end of September.
Gangster Hero, a newer entrant, saw a significant increase in downloads from 7K in late August to over 300K by the end of September. Active users followed a similar trend, starting at 7K and soaring to 572K by the end of Q3.
Dude Theft Wars FPS Open world maintained steady weekly downloads, peaking at 40K in mid-July. Revenue showed a slight increase mid-quarter, reaching $45 in mid-July. Active users hovered around 100K to 130K throughout the quarter, with minor fluctuations.
Car Cops experienced a peak in downloads at 115K in late July, followed by a decline to around 18K by the end of September. Revenue saw a gradual increase, peaking at $11 in mid-September. Active users peaked at 117K in early August, declining to approximately 34K by the end of the quarter.
